Transaction 18068ab380ed9f3269ef9386951a37cce5dd7cdfcc082ec0772b8fbf309c8661
1 Input
1 Output
-
18068ab380ed9f3269ef9386951a37cce5dd7cdfcc082ec0772b8fbf309c8661:0
- value
- 13657910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4107b283d1c72a84ec3a21a6aabfe258b373352 OP_EQUAL
- address
- 3M2JvLXdNLXk9sPrrRebYXoek1d9WvF54j